Senior Lawyer Salary in Bethlehem, PA: $209,726 (2026)
Quick Answer:The top tier of lawyers working in Bethlehem, PA — those at or above the 90th percentile — pull in $209,726/year or more for 2026, based on BLS OEWS 2025 estimates for SOC 23-1011. Strip back Bethlehem's price premium (BEA RPP 97.4, 3% below national) and that top-decile pay carries the same buying power as $215,324 in average-cost America. The 55% spread above city median typically rewards 7+ years of practice or specialty credentials.

Maximizing Your Lawyer Earnings in Bethlehem
Specific legal specializations drive higher salaries in Bethlehem. Areas like mergers and acquisitions, securities law, and intellectual property frequently command premium pay. Compensation can also vary significantly based on employer types, with BigLaw firms offering some of the highest senior lawyer pay in PA, while boutique firms may focus on niche areas and generally provide more limited salary scales. Advancement routes, such as transitioning from associate to partner or from counsel to general counsel, offer pathways for increased earnings. Furthermore, advanced credentials such as an LL.M. or patent bar registration can enhance one’s salary potential. It's crucial to consider the broader factors that influence compensation, including the firm’s prestige, regional market conditions, and the balance between billable hours and work-life balance, especially in a market like Bethlehem where the cost of living indexes below the national average.
